- Remove all console.log/debug statements from production code - Add NODE_ENV checks for development-only logging - Remove test scripts (test-feedback, test-image-security, test-backup-*, test-restore) - Remove one-time fix scripts (fix-temp-photos, fix-migration-state, mark-migration-applied) - Remove sensitive files (.env.backup, ADMIN_CREDENTIALS.txt) - Update package.json to remove references to deleted scripts - Replace console statements with logger utility in backend - Secure error boundaries to not expose stack traces in production This makes the codebase production-ready with no debug output or test scripts. 🤖 Generated with [Claude Code](https://claude.ai/code) Co-Authored-By: Claude <noreply@anthropic.com>
